How they compare
Lebanon currently reports 0.495 against 0.471 in Pakistan, a difference of 0.024.
That makes Lebanon's figure about 1.1 times Pakistan's.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 108 shared years of data; in 1918 it was Lebanon ahead.
Lebanon ranks 71st and Pakistan ranks 73rd of 173 countries.
Lebanon has averaged higher in every one of the 12 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Lebanon | Pakist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1910s | 0.816 | 0.446 | 0.37 | Lebanon |
| 1920s | 0.7064 | 0.446 | 0.2604 | Lebanon |
| 1930s | 0.679 | 0.343 | 0.336 | Lebanon |
| 1940s | 0.7348 | 0.303 | 0.4318 | Lebanon |
| 1950s | 0.7417 | 0.5338 | 0.2079 | Lebanon |
| 1960s | 0.694 | 0.6792 | 0.0148 | Lebanon |
| 1970s | 0.7334 | 0.6184 | 0.115 | Lebanon |
| 1980s | 0.7606 | 0.6489 | 0.1117 | Lebanon |
| 1990s | 0.7047 | 0.4899 | 0.2148 | Lebanon |
| 2000s | 0.6565 | 0.557 | 0.0995 | Lebanon |
| 2010s | 0.5357 | 0.3088 | 0.2269 | Lebanon |
| 2020s | 0.4958 | 0.3597 | 0.1362 | Lebanon |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Central estimate of the extent to which the executive is unconstrained by the legislature, judiciary, electoral management body, and other oversight.
